Transaction af37892440fb2eafddaaf694a75f15b04a38d4a0e59e25d0b8424fec4fcacbe1

1 Input
2 Outputs
  • af37892440fb2eafddaaf694a75f15b04a38d4a0e59e25d0b8424fec4fcacbe1:0
  • value  2298345
    address  35BRbHZEWQgCtWXb5WD3Fi4rtaLCdQbr61
  • af37892440fb2eafddaaf694a75f15b04a38d4a0e59e25d0b8424fec4fcacbe1:1
  • value  703114
    address  3HmNtMV6n5fZowmXfERdq3fTBv1WdBLhTa